Output 95cb94fdf3e4d8cadf0d2e8db42ec428939594c708e9233f58827be7175b8660:3

value
807000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3eb59559ff26479fb2da04245d91febd64386c08 OP_EQUAL
address
37QbM5D4hD3obHikTBYd89bPAoTE5R74ix
transaction
95cb94fdf3e4d8cadf0d2e8db42ec428939594c708e9233f58827be7175b8660
spent
true